What Makes a Dishwasher Eco Friendly?
Several key features contribute to making a dishwasher eco-friendly:
- Energy Efficiency: Eco-friendly dishwashers are designed to consume less electricity, often exceeding Energy Star ratings. This means they use advanced technologies that optimize energy use during cycles, helping to reduce overall carbon footprints.
- Water Conservation: The best eco-friendly dishwashers utilize innovative water-saving technologies, using significantly less water per load compared to traditional models. Many modern dishwashers can clean a full load with as little as 3 gallons of water, which is crucial for conserving this vital resource.
- Eco Wash Cycles: Many eco-friendly dishwashers come with dedicated wash cycles that use lower temperatures and less water while still effectively cleaning dishes. These cycles are specifically designed to reduce energy and water consumption while maintaining cleaning performance.
- Recyclable Materials: Environmentally conscious dishwashers are often constructed using recyclable and sustainable materials. This not only reduces the environmental impact during production but also ensures that the unit can be recycled at the end of its lifespan.
- Quiet Operation: Eco-friendly models often operate more quietly than traditional dishwashers, thanks to better insulation and sound-dampening technologies. This not only enhances user comfort but also indicates a more efficient design that minimizes energy loss.
- Advanced Filtration Systems: Some eco-friendly dishwashers feature advanced filtration systems that ensure water is reused efficiently within the wash cycles. These systems help to maintain clean water throughout the washing process, reducing overall water waste.

What Features Should You Look for in the Best Eco Friendly Dishwashers?
When searching for the best eco-friendly dishwashers, it’s essential to consider features that promote energy efficiency and sustainable practices.
- Energy Star Certification: Look for dishwashers that have the Energy Star label, which indicates they meet strict energy efficiency guidelines set by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ency. These models typically use less water and energy than standard models, significantly reducing your carbon footprint.
- Water Efficiency: Choose a dishwasher that utilizes advanced technology to minimize water usage per cycle. Some eco-friendly dishwashers can clean dishes effectively while using as little as 3 gallons of water, compared to older models that may use over 6 gallons.
- Soil Sensors: Dishwashers equipped with soil sensors can detect how dirty the dishes are and adjust the wash cycle accordingly. This feature not only optimizes cleaning performance but also conserves water and energy by avoiding unnecessary long cycles for lightly soiled dishes.
- Eco Wash Cycle: Many modern dishwashers come with an eco wash or similar cycle designed specifically for energy and water conservation. This cycle uses lower temperatures and longer wash times to clean lightly soiled dishes efficiently, minimizing resource consumption.
- Durability and Repairability: Selecting a dishwasher made from durable materials can extend its lifespan, which is a key factor in eco-friendliness. Additionally, models that are designed for easy repairs can help reduce waste by allowing you to fix rather than replace the unit.
- Noise Level: While not directly linked to environmental impact, a quieter dishwasher can enhance your living environment, encouraging more frequent use without disrupting your daily activities. Look for models with a decibel rating of 44 dBA or lower for a peaceful experience.
- Recyclable Materials: Opt for dishwashers that incorporate recyclable materials in their construction. This can help reduce the environmental impact of manufacturing and disposal, aligning with eco-friendly principles.

What Factors Affect the Energy and Water Efficiency of Dishwashers?
Several factors influence the energy and water efficiency of dishwashers, especially those marketed as eco-friendly.
- Energy Star Certification: Dishwashers that have the Energy Star label meet strict energy efficiency guidelines set by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ency. These models use less energy than standard dishwashers, often by incorporating advanced technology to optimize water heating and cycle times.
- Water Usage: The amount of water a dishwasher uses per cycle is a critical factor in its efficiency. Eco-friendly models typically use 3 to 5 gallons per load, significantly less than washing by hand, which can consume up to 20 gallons, thus conserving both water and energy.
- Wash Cycle Options: Many modern dishwashers offer multiple wash cycle options tailored to different load types and soil levels. Eco-friendly dishwashers often feature a quick wash or eco mode that runs shorter cycles at lower temperatures, reducing energy and water consumption while still providing effective cleaning.
- Insulation and Design: The design and insulation of a dishwasher can impact its efficiency. Well-insulated models retain heat more effectively, reducing the energy required to heat water during operation, while smart designs ensure optimal water circulation for thorough cleaning.
- Load Capacity and Configuration: The capacity of a dishwasher and how well it is designed to load dishes can influence its efficiency. Models with flexible loading configurations allow users to maximize space and wash more dishes simultaneously, reducing the number of cycles needed and conserving resources.
- Soil Sensor Technology: Some eco-friendly dishwashers are equipped with soil sensors that detect how dirty the dishes are and adjust the wash cycle accordingly. This technology optimizes water and energy use, ensuring that only the necessary resources are expended for effective cleaning.
- Heat Recovery Systems: Advanced models may include heat recovery systems that capture and reuse heat from the wash water during cycles. This feature not only enhances energy efficiency but also contributes to faster drying times, further reducing energy consumption.
